Handover note for the eng sync — nightly search reindex (Quarrow): the job moved from the old cron host to the scheduler service last week. Runtime is now ~45 minutes; alerts fire if it exceeds 90. One retry happens automatically before paging. Kess owns it going forward. Run history and manual-trigger instructions are documented here.

runbook for taduf-kawef: https://confluence.qorvelsys.internal/projects/display/display/pages

## Service Accounts — Report Builder Sorting

The Quillview report builder uses a stable merge sort, so rows with equal keys keep their original order. If a customer reports "shuffled" results, check whether the svc-quillview-reports account has the deterministic-sort flag enabled. Support can verify this via the Flagboard internal API using the key below.

gateway credential: kto23_LX9A4ys6i4nzHtpOLNLodKK

INTERNAL MEMO
Re: Raffle drums for the staff party

The two raffle drums hired from Finchmoor Party Supply will be collected Thursday afternoon by Redlane Couriers. Please have both drums boxed and at reception by 15:00, hire agreement taped to the larger box. When the driver arrives, pass along the instruction noted below.

courier memo of yawep-yafog: the pramir ulaix courier leaves the ulavan aldix frair zorok oliiel joreth rusdor fenvan ledger at gate 1305 under passcode 514738